BPSOSRB ;BHAM ISC/FCS/DRS/FLS - Process claim on processing queue ;06/01/2004
Source file <BPSOSRB.m>
Package | Total | Call Graph |
---|---|---|
E Claims Management Engine | 11 | $$REVERSE^BPSECA8 $$RXDEL^BPSOS (EN,PREVISLY)^BPSOSIZ (LOG,LOGARRAY)^BPSOSL (LOG59,TASK)^BPSOSQA ($$IEN59,$$LOCKNOW,$$LOCKRF,$$NOW,$$STATUS,UNLCKRF,UNLOCK)^BPSOSRX ($$ACTIVATE,$$INACTIVE,$$INPROCES,READMORE,UPD7759)^BPSOSRX4 $$PAYABLE^BPSOSRX5 $$GETNXREQ^BPSOSRX6 (ERROR,SETSTAT)^BPSOSU $$COB59^BPSUTIL2 |
VA FileMan | 1 | ^DIE |
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Package | Total | Caller Graph |
---|---|---|
E Claims Management Engine | 1 | BPSOSIZ |
Name | Comments | DBIA/ICR reference |
---|---|---|
BACKGR | ;
|
|
LOG77(IEN59,BPIEN77) | ; Log entire contents of the request.
|
|
BACKGR1(TYPE,KEY1,KEY2,TIME,MOREDATA,IEN59,BPS77) | ;
; Resolve multiple requests |
|
ERROR(BPS77,IEN59,ERROR) | ;
|
|
REVERSE(IEN59,MOREDATA,BP77) | ;
|
Name | Field # of Occurrence |
---|---|
$$REVERSE^BPSECA8 | REVERSE+44 |
$$RXDEL^BPSOS | BACKGR1+9 |
EN^BPSOSIZ | BACKGR1+29 |
PREVISLY^BPSOSIZ | REVERSE+40 |
LOG^BPSOSL | BACKGR+10, BACKGR+18, BACKGR+24, BACKGR+26, BACKGR+33, LOG77+3, BACKGR1+3, BACKGR1+28, ERROR+4, ERROR+8 , ERROR+9, ERROR+16, REVERSE+10, REVERSE+33, REVERSE+36, REVERSE+46, REVERSE+54 |
LOGARRAY^BPSOSL | LOG77+4 |
LOG59^BPSOSQA | REVERSE+37 |
TASK^BPSOSQA | REVERSE+60 |
$$IEN59^BPSOSRX | BACKGR+8, BACKGR+20 |
$$LOCKNOW^BPSOSRX | BACKGR+1 |
$$LOCKRF^BPSOSRX | BACKGR+9 |
$$NOW^BPSOSRX | BACKGR+4 |
$$STATUS^BPSOSRX | BACKGR1+6 |
UNLCKRF^BPSOSRX | BACKGR+36 |
UNLOCK^BPSOSRX | BACKGR+37 |
$$ACTIVATE^BPSOSRX4 | ERROR+15 |
$$INACTIVE^BPSOSRX4 | ERROR+7 |
$$INPROCES^BPSOSRX4 | BACKGR+32 |
READMORE^BPSOSRX4 | BACKGR+30 |
UPD7759^BPSOSRX4 | REVERSE+4 |
$$PAYABLE^BPSOSRX5 | BACKGR1+7 |
$$GETNXREQ^BPSOSRX6 | ERROR+13 |
ERROR^BPSOSU | REVERSE+47 |
SETSTAT^BPSOSU | REVERSE+14, REVERSE+15, REVERSE+57 |
$$COB59^BPSUTIL2 | BACKGR1+5, REVERSE+32 |
^DIE | REVERSE+28, REVERSE+51 |
Name | Line Occurrences (* Changed, ! Killed) |
---|---|
^BPS(9002313.77 - [#9002313.77] | BACKGR+6, BACKGR+7, BACKGR+12, BACKGR+14, BACKGR+17, BACKGR+19, BACKGR+22, BACKGR+29, LOG77+2, BACKGR1+12 |
^BPSC - [#9002313.02] | REVERSE+54 |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
A | LOG77+1~, LOG77+2* |
BP77 | REVERSE~, REVERSE+4 |
BPCOBIND | BACKGR+3~, BACKGR+19*, BACKGR+20, BACKGR1+2~, BACKGR1+5*, BACKGR1+6 |
BPIEN77 | BACKGR+3~, BACKGR+12*, BACKGR+14, BACKGR+17, BACKGR+19, BACKGR+22, BACKGR+23, BACKGR+24, BACKGR+25, BACKGR+29 , BACKGR+30, BACKGR+32, BACKGR+33, BACKGR+34, LOG77~, LOG77+2, LOG77+3 |
BPLCKRX | BACKGR+3~, BACKGR+9*, BACKGR+36 |
BPNOW | BACKGR+2~, BACKGR+4*, BACKGR+14 |
BPNXT77 | ERROR+3~, ERROR+13*, ERROR+14, ERROR+15, ERROR+16 |
BPQ | BACKGR+3~, BACKGR+11*, BACKGR+12, BACKGR+14*, BACKGR+17*, BACKGR+35* |
BPRETV | ERROR+3~, ERROR+7*, ERROR+8, ERROR+15*, ERROR+16 |
BPS77 | BACKGR1~, BACKGR1+3, BACKGR1+12, BACKGR1+19, BACKGR1+25, BACKGR1+29, ERROR~, ERROR+1, ERROR+4, ERROR+7 , ERROR+13 |
BPSCOB | REVERSE+31~, REVERSE+32*, REVERSE+33 |
BPUNTIL | BACKGR+2~, BACKGR+14* |
DA | REVERSE+21~, REVERSE+22*, REVERSE+50* |
DIE | REVERSE+21~, REVERSE+22*, REVERSE+50* |
DR | REVERSE+21~, REVERSE+23*, REVERSE+24*, REVERSE+25*, REVERSE+26*, REVERSE+50* |
ERROR | ERROR~, ERROR+2*, ERROR+4, ERROR+7 |
GRPLAN | BACKGR+3~ |
IEN59 | BACKGR+2~, BACKGR+18, BACKGR+20*, BACKGR+23, BACKGR+24, BACKGR+25, BACKGR+26, BACKGR+32, BACKGR+33, BACKGR+34 , LOG77~, LOG77+3, LOG77+4, BACKGR1~, BACKGR1+3, BACKGR1+5, BACKGR1+19, BACKGR1+25, BACKGR1+28, BACKGR1+29 , ERROR~, ERROR+4, ERROR+8, ERROR+9, ERROR+13, ERROR+16, REVERSE~, REVERSE+4, REVERSE+10, REVERSE+14 , REVERSE+15, REVERSE+22, REVERSE+32, REVERSE+33, REVERSE+36, REVERSE+37, REVERSE+40, REVERSE+44, REVERSE+46, REVERSE+47 , REVERSE+50, REVERSE+54, REVERSE+57 |
IEN59PR | BACKGR+2~, BACKGR+8*, BACKGR+9, BACKGR+10, BACKGR+36 |
KEY1 | BACKGR+2~, BACKGR+6*, BACKGR+7, BACKGR+8, BACKGR+9, BACKGR+12, BACKGR+20, BACKGR+34, BACKGR+36, BACKGR1~ , BACKGR1+3, BACKGR1+6, BACKGR1+9 |
KEY2 | BACKGR+2~, BACKGR+7*, BACKGR+8, BACKGR+9, BACKGR+12, BACKGR+20, BACKGR+34, BACKGR+36, BACKGR1~, BACKGR1+3 , BACKGR1+6, BACKGR1+9 |
MOREDATA | BACKGR+28~, BACKGR+30, BACKGR+34, BACKGR1~, BACKGR1+25, BACKGR1+29, REVERSE~ |
MOREDATA("REQ | DTTM" , REVERSE+26, IEN" , REVERSE+25, TYPE" , REVERSE+25 |
MOREDATA("REV | ERSAL REASON" , REVERSE+24 |
MOREDATA("RX | ACTION" , REVERSE+24 |
MOREDATA("SUB | MIT TIME" , BACKGR1+22*, REVERSE+23 |
MOREDATA("USER" | REVERSE+23 |
MSG | REVERSE+1~, REVERSE+9*, REVERSE+10 |
PAYABLE | BACKGR1+2~, BACKGR1+7*, BACKGR1+14, BACKGR1+16 |
RESULT | BACKGR1+2~, BACKGR1+6*, BACKGR1+7, BACKGR1+14, BACKGR1+16 |
RETVAL | REVERSE+1~ |
REV | REVERSE+1~, REVERSE+44*, REVERSE+45, REVERSE+50, REVERSE+54 |
SKIP | BACKGR1+2~, BACKGR1+4*, BACKGR1+9*, BACKGR1+14*, BACKGR1+16*, BACKGR1+19 |
SKIPREAS | BACKGR1+2~, BACKGR1+9*, BACKGR1+14*, BACKGR1+16*, BACKGR1+19 |
TIME | BACKGR+28~, BACKGR+29*, BACKGR+34, BACKGR1~, BACKGR1+22 |
TYPE | BACKGR+2~, BACKGR+22*, BACKGR+23, BACKGR+26, BACKGR+34, BACKGR1~, BACKGR1+3, BACKGR1+8, BACKGR1+16, BACKGR1+25 |
U | BACKGR+14, BACKGR+17, BACKGR+19, BACKGR+22, BACKGR+29, BACKGR1+6, BACKGR1+12, REVERSE+54 |